keys:将字典中的键以列表的方式返回。(注意区分和items的区别) iterkeys:返回针对键的迭代器。 pop:获得对应给定键的值,然后将键-值对删除。 popitem:弹出一个随机的项, setdefault:既能获得与给定键相关的值,又能在字典中不含有该键的情况下设定相应的键值。 update:用一个字典更新另一个字典。 d={'1':'d...
dict().items():以列表返回一个视图对象 test_dict = {'apple': 1, 'banana': 1, 'beef': 1} print(f"test_dict.items()元素的数据类型: {type(test_dict.items())}") print(f"字典中的键值对:") for i in test_dict.items(): print(i) 输出结果 dict().keys():返回一个视图对象 test_...
dict.get(key)方法和dict[key]的最大不同点:在键不存在时,前者不会报错,后者会报错: >>> cvtutorials = {'host_name': 'cvtutorials', 'domain_name_suffix': 'com'} >>> cvtutorials.get("host_name") 'cvtutorials' >>> cvtutorials.get("cv") >>> cvtutorials["cv"] Traceback (most rece...
字典keys,valuse和items方法分别返回字典的键列表,值列表和(key,value)对元组 dict.items() 返回一个包含字典中(键, 值)对元组的列表 dict.keys() 返回一个包含字典中键的列表 dict.values() 返回一个包含字典中所有值的列表 dict.iter*() 方法iteritems(), iterkeys(), itervalues()与它们对应的非迭代方法...
dict.items()#以列表返回可遍历的(键, 值) 元组数组dict.keys()#返回一个迭代器,可以使用 list() 来转换为列表dict.values()#返回一个迭代器,可以使用 list() 来转换为列表dict.update(dict2)#把字典dict2的键/值对更新到dict里pop(key[,default])#删除字典给定键 key 所对应的值,返回值为被删除的值...
:1,'two':2}print(a,type(a))# output: {'one': 1, 'two': 2} <class 'dict'>a.update...
items() #以列表返回可遍历的(键, 值) 元组数组 keys() #以列表返回一个字典所有的键 setdefault(key, default=None) #和get()类似, 但如果键不存在于字典中,将会添加键并将值设为default update(dict2) #把字典dict2的键/值对更新到dict里
在云计算领域中,Python dict 是一种常用的数据结构,用于存储键值对(key-value pairs)。在 Python 中,dict 是一种可变对象,可以通过键直接访问、更新或删除其中的元素...
dict.items()返回一个可迭代对象,它把k:v健值对转换成元组存为列表的元素,其结果类似“列表嵌套元组”,实例代码: 我们可以通过遍历items()把字典dict编排成一个新列表list,相当于list(dict)方法的实现过程,代码如下: 提取字典里的所有键:keys() 方法返回一个可迭代对象,相当于字典的key集合,可以使用 list() ...